How to Maintain and Clean Vinyl Flooring Properly

Vinyl flooring cleaning and maintenance are essential to keep your floor looking new and durable over time. However, many homeowners do not follow the correct routine. As a result, the floor can lose its appearance faster.

Vinyl Flooring Cleaning and Maintenance Tips

First, you should sweep or vacuum the floor regularly. This is important because dirt and debris can damage the surface. For example, small particles can act like sandpaper and create scratches.

Therefore, removing dust frequently helps protect the finish. It also improves the overall appearance of your flooring.

Next, use a damp mop with a mild cleaner. In most cases, this is enough for deeper cleaning. However, av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ive products. They can damage the protective layer of the vinyl flooring.

How to Protect Your Vinyl Flooring

In addition, you can follow simple steps to extend the life of your floor. These habits are part of a good vinyl flooring cleaning and maintenance routine.

  • Use protective pads under furniture to prevent scratches
  • Place doormats at entrances to reduce dirt and moisture
  • Clean spills immediately to avoid stains or long-term damage

For instance, doormats help keep unwanted debris outside. Because of this, your floor stays cleaner for longer.

If spills happen, clean them right away. Although vinyl flooring is water-resistant, keeping the surface dry is still important. This helps maintain both durability and appearance.
